What’s A Faang Software Engineer’s Salary & How To Get There?

 thumbnail

What’s A Faang Software Engineer’s Salary & How To Get There?

Published Mar 18, 25
4 min read
[=headercontent]What To Expect In A Faang Data Science Technical Interview [/headercontent] [=image]
The Ultimate Roadmap To Crack Faang Coding Interviews

Tesla Software Engineer Interview Guide – Key Concepts & Skills




[/video]

These questions are then shown your future recruiters so you don't get asked the same inquiries two times. Each job interviewer will certainly evaluate you on the 4 primary attributes Google seeks when employing: Depending upon the precise job you're using for these qualities may be damaged down better. "Role-related expertise and experience" can be broken down right into "Protection design" or "Incident reaction" for a site integrity designer duty.

Software Engineer Interview Guide – Mastering Data Structures & Algorithms

Mock Interviews For Software Engineers – How To Practice & Improve


In this center area, Google's job interviewers typically repeat the inquiries they asked you, document your answers thoroughly, and offer you a score for every feature (e.g. "Poor", "Mixed", "Excellent", "Exceptional"). Finally interviewers will compose a recap of your performance and supply an overall referral on whether they think Google must be employing you or otherwise (e.g.

How To Master Whiteboard Coding Interviews

At this stage, the hiring committee will make a suggestion on whether Google need to hire you or otherwise. If the hiring board suggests that you obtain hired you'll typically begin your team matching process. To put it simply, you'll speak with hiring supervisors and one or several of them will need to be ready to take you in their group in order for you to get a deal from the firm.

Yes, Google software engineer interviews are really tough. The interview procedure is designed to extensively evaluate a candidate's technological abilities and total suitability for the duty. It usually covers coding meetings where you'll require to use data structures or formulas to fix troubles, you can additionally expect behavioral "tell me concerning a time." concerns.

Top Software Engineering Interview Questions And How To Answer Them

Our company believe in data-driven meeting prep work and have actually used Glassdoor data to recognize the sorts of concerns which are most frequently asked at Google. For coding meetings, we have actually damaged down the questions you'll be asked by subcategories (e.g. Arrays/ Strings , Graphs / Trees , and so on) to ensure that you can prioritize what to research and practice first. Google software application designers resolve several of one of the most hard issues the company faces with code. It's therefore essential that they have strong problem-solving skills. This is the part of the meeting where you intend to reveal that you assume in an organized means and create code that's precise, bug-free, and quick.

Please keep in mind the listed here omits system layout and behavior concerns, which we'll cover later in this article. Graphs/ Trees (39% of questions, a lot of regular) Arrays/ Strings (26%) Dynamic programs (12%) Recursion (12%) Geometry/ Mathematics (11% of questions, least regular) Listed below, we have actually listed common instances made use of at Google for every of these various question kinds.

Netflix Software Engineer Interview Guide – Insider Advice

Software Developer (Sde) Interview & Placement Guide – How To Stand Out


"Given a binary tree, locate the maximum path sum. "We can turn figures by 180 degrees to form brand-new numbers.

When 2, 3, 4, 5, and 7 are revolved 180 degrees, they end up being void. A complicated number is a number that when turned 180 degrees ends up being a various number with each number valid. "Offered a matrix of N rows and M columns.

When it tries to relocate right into a blocked cell, its bumper sensor detects the barrier and it remains on the current cell. Style an algorithm to clean up the whole room making use of only the 4 offered APIs revealed listed below." (Solution) Apply a SnapshotArray that supports pre-defined interfaces (note: see web link for more information).

He Ultimate Guide To Coding Interview Preparation In 2025

The Star Method – How To Answer Behavioral Interview Questions

How To Get A Faang Job Without Paying For An Expensive Bootcamp


Return the minimal number of turnings so that all the worths in A are the same, or all the worths in B are the same.

In some cases, when inputting a personality c, the trick might get long pushed, and the character will certainly be entered 1 or even more times. You check out the typed characters of the key-board. Return True if it is feasible that it was your close friends name, with some characters (perhaps none) being long pushed." (Solution) "Provided a string S and a string T, discover the minimum home window in S which will have all the personalities in T in intricacy O(n)." (Remedy) "Provided a listing of inquiry words, return the variety of words that are stretchy." Keep in mind: see link for even more information.

"A strobogrammatic number is a number that looks the exact same when turned 180 degrees (looked at upside down). "Given a binary tree, locate the size of the longest path where each node in the path has the same worth.